Kodi Documentation 22.0
Kodi is an open source media player and entertainment hub.
|
This is the complete list of members for ADDON::CAddonMgr, including all inherited members.
AddonsFromRepoXML(const RepositoryDirInfo &repo, const std::string &xml, std::vector< AddonInfoPtr > &addons) | ADDON::CAddonMgr | |
AddToUpdateableAddons(AddonPtr &pAddon) | ADDON::CAddonMgr | |
AddUpdateRuleToList(const std::string &id, AddonUpdateRule updateRule) | ADDON::CAddonMgr | |
CAddonMgr() | ADDON::CAddonMgr | |
CAddonMgr(const CAddonMgr &)=delete | ADDON::CAddonMgr | |
CanAddonBeDisabled(const std::string &ID) | ADDON::CAddonMgr | |
CanAddonBeEnabled(const std::string &id) | ADDON::CAddonMgr | |
CanAddonBeInstalled(const AddonPtr &addon) | ADDON::CAddonMgr | |
CanUninstall(const AddonPtr &addon) | ADDON::CAddonMgr | |
CheckAndInstallAddonUpdates(bool wait) const | ADDON::CAddonMgr | |
DeInit() | ADDON::CAddonMgr | |
DisableAddon(const std::string &ID, AddonDisabledReason disabledReason) | ADDON::CAddonMgr | |
DisableIncompatibleAddons(const std::vector< AddonInfoPtr > &incompatible) | ADDON::CAddonMgr | |
EnableAddon(const std::string &ID) | ADDON::CAddonMgr | |
Events() | ADDON::CAddonMgr | inline |
FindAddon(const std::string &addonId, const std::string &origin, const CAddonVersion &addonVersion) | ADDON::CAddonMgr | |
FindAddons() | ADDON::CAddonMgr | |
FindInstallableById(const std::string &addonId, AddonPtr &addon) | ADDON::CAddonMgr | |
GetAddon(const std::string &id, AddonPtr &addon, AddonType type, OnlyEnabled onlyEnabled) const | ADDON::CAddonMgr | |
GetAddon(const std::string &id, AddonPtr &addon, OnlyEnabled onlyEnabled) const | ADDON::CAddonMgr | |
GetAddonInfo(const std::string &id, AddonType type) const | ADDON::CAddonMgr | |
GetAddonInfos(std::vector< AddonInfoPtr > &addonInfos, bool onlyEnabled, AddonType type) const | ADDON::CAddonMgr | |
GetAddonInfos(bool onlyEnabled, const std::vector< AddonType > &types) const | ADDON::CAddonMgr | |
GetAddonOriginType(const AddonPtr &addon) const | ADDON::CAddonMgr | |
GetAddons(VECADDONS &addons) const | ADDON::CAddonMgr | |
GetAddons(VECADDONS &addons, AddonType type) | ADDON::CAddonMgr | |
GetAddonsForUpdate(VECADDONS &addons) const | ADDON::CAddonMgr | |
GetAddonsWithAvailableUpdate() const | ADDON::CAddonMgr | |
GetAvailableUpdates() const | ADDON::CAddonMgr | |
GetCallbackForType(AddonType type) | ADDON::CAddonMgr | |
GetCompatibleVersions(const std::string &addonId) const | ADDON::CAddonMgr | |
GetDepsRecursive(const std::string &id, OnlyEnabledRootAddon onlyEnabledRootAddon) | ADDON::CAddonMgr | |
GetDisabledAddonInfos(std::vector< AddonInfoPtr > &addonInfos, AddonType type) const | ADDON::CAddonMgr | |
GetDisabledAddonInfos(std::vector< AddonInfoPtr > &addonInfos, AddonType type, AddonDisabledReason disabledReason) const | ADDON::CAddonMgr | |
GetDisabledAddons(VECADDONS &addons) | ADDON::CAddonMgr | |
GetDisabledAddons(VECADDONS &addons, AddonType type) | ADDON::CAddonMgr | |
GetIncompatibleEnabledAddonInfos(std::vector< AddonInfoPtr > &incompatible) const | ADDON::CAddonMgr | |
GetInstallableAddons(VECADDONS &addons) | ADDON::CAddonMgr | |
GetInstallableAddons(VECADDONS &addons, AddonType type) | ADDON::CAddonMgr | |
GetInstalledAddons(VECADDONS &addons) | ADDON::CAddonMgr | |
GetInstalledAddons(VECADDONS &addons, AddonType type) | ADDON::CAddonMgr | |
GetLastAvailableUpdatesCountAsString() const | ADDON::CAddonMgr | |
GetOrphanedDependencies() const | ADDON::CAddonMgr | |
GetOutdatedAddons() const | ADDON::CAddonMgr | |
GetTempAddonBasePath() | ADDON::CAddonMgr | inline |
HasAddons(AddonType type) | ADDON::CAddonMgr | |
HasAvailableUpdates() | ADDON::CAddonMgr | |
HasInstalledAddons(AddonType type) | ADDON::CAddonMgr | |
HasType(const std::string &id, AddonType type) | ADDON::CAddonMgr | |
Init() | ADDON::CAddonMgr | |
IsAddonDisabled(const std::string &ID) const | ADDON::CAddonMgr | |
IsAddonDisabledExcept(const std::string &ID, AddonDisabledReason disabledReason) const | ADDON::CAddonMgr | |
IsAddonDisabledWithReason(const std::string &ID, AddonDisabledReason disabledReason) const | ADDON::CAddonMgr | |
IsAddonInstalled(const std::string &ID) | ADDON::CAddonMgr | |
IsAddonInstalled(const std::string &ID, const std::string &origin) const | ADDON::CAddonMgr | |
IsAddonInstalled(const std::string &ID, const std::string &origin, const CAddonVersion &version) | ADDON::CAddonMgr | |
IsAutoUpdateable(const std::string &id) const | ADDON::CAddonMgr | |
IsBundledAddon(const std::string &id) | ADDON::CAddonMgr | |
IsCompatible(const std::shared_ptr< const IAddon > &addon) const | ADDON::CAddonMgr | |
IsCompatible(const AddonInfoPtr &addonInfo) const | ADDON::CAddonMgr | |
IsOptionalSystemAddon(const std::string &id) | ADDON::CAddonMgr | |
IsOrphaned(const std::shared_ptr< IAddon > &addon, const std::vector< std::shared_ptr< IAddon > > &allAddons) const | ADDON::CAddonMgr | |
IsRequiredSystemAddon(const std::string &id) | ADDON::CAddonMgr | |
IsSystemAddon(const std::string &id) | ADDON::CAddonMgr | |
LoadAddon(const std::string &addonId, const std::string &origin, const CAddonVersion &addonVersion) | ADDON::CAddonMgr | |
LoadAddonDescription(const std::string &path, AddonPtr &addon) | ADDON::CAddonMgr | |
MigrateAddons() | ADDON::CAddonMgr | |
OnPostUnInstall(const std::string &id) | ADDON::CAddonMgr | |
PublishEventAutoUpdateStateChanged(const std::string &id) | ADDON::CAddonMgr | |
PublishInstanceAdded(const std::string &addonId, AddonInstanceId instanceId) | ADDON::CAddonMgr | |
PublishInstanceRemoved(const std::string &addonId, AddonInstanceId instanceId) | ADDON::CAddonMgr | |
RegisterAddonMgrCallback(AddonType type, IAddonMgrCallback *cb) | ADDON::CAddonMgr | |
ReInit() | ADDON::CAddonMgr | inline |
ReloadSettings(const std::string &addonId, AddonInstanceId instanceId) | ADDON::CAddonMgr | |
RemoveAllUpdateRulesFromList(const std::string &id) | ADDON::CAddonMgr | |
RemoveFromUpdateableAddons(AddonPtr &pAddon) | ADDON::CAddonMgr | |
RemoveUpdateRuleFromList(const std::string &id, AddonUpdateRule updateRule) | ADDON::CAddonMgr | |
ServicesHasStarted() const | ADDON::CAddonMgr | |
SetAddonOrigin(const std::string &addonId, const std::string &repoAddonId, bool isUpdate) | ADDON::CAddonMgr | |
UnloadAddon(const std::string &addonId) | ADDON::CAddonMgr | |
UnloadEvents() | ADDON::CAddonMgr | inline |
UnregisterAddonMgrCallback(AddonType type) | ADDON::CAddonMgr | |
UpdateDisabledReason(const std::string &id, AddonDisabledReason newDisabledReason) | ADDON::CAddonMgr | |
UpdateLastUsed(const std::string &id) | ADDON::CAddonMgr | |
~CAddonMgr() | ADDON::CAddonMgr | virtual |